New presidential spokesman gives recognition to his Hakka heritage

President Ma Ying-jeou's new spokesman, Fan Chiang Tai-chi, said Wednesday that as a Hakka, his new post is not only an honor for himself, but also a recognition of the achievements of Hakka people.
